Undertake or be working towards Temporary Works Supervisor (TWS) duties for temporary works operations
Consistently demonstrate, promote and develop high standards of safety behaviour, leading by example.
Manage the performance of the supply chain to ensure key contract objectives are delivered
Maximise staff engagement through actively contributing at team talks, address staff issues, identifying development needs, deliver as appropriate toolbox talks, safety briefings and team briefs
Manage engineering teams to optimise operational activities thus ensuring key business objectives are delivered
Support the Area Manager in identifying areas for improvement, leading on initiatives as appropriate
Continually monitor operative’s performance and foster a culture of team working and safety, creating a culture of zero tolerance of safety and compliance breaches and working towards Injury Free Environment
Carry out standby and call out duties as required
Act as a key advocate for the contract with senior representatives from local authority organisations to promote Cadent activities
Undertake or assist with incident reporting, investigations, submission of final reports as well as close out of remedial actions
Manage the engineering teams ensuring the highest standard of customer service and safety standards are delivered, providing assurance though audit and inspection, taking appropriate action to address areas of improvement
Develop a programme of work ensuring that projects are issued, monitored, delivered (to cost and time) in accordance with legislative, regulatory, Cadent technical standards, policies and procedures
to successfully deliver a Defueling & Decommissioning programme, a first of a kind
Act as competent person for Flow Stopping and Commissioning Operations in line with Cadent Safe Control of Operations, Main Laying and Service Laying Procedures
to successfully deliver projects that maximise the lifespan of their generating stations
Investigate and resolve customer queries, claims and complaints in an expedient and professional manner

Commitment to deliver low-carbon whole-life solutions to every client by 2023 and to be net zero by 2035
Net zero target for operational and supply-chain emissions (Scope 1, 2 by 2035; Scope 3 by 2045)
Emission intensity (tCO₂e/£M revenue) reduced by 10% compared to baseline
Introduction of a Low Carbon Materials mandate for concrete, cement and asphalt
October 2024 Board-approved climate transition plan with accelerated decarbonisation targets
Carbon reduction tool deployed in 2024 for enhanced Scope 1, 2 and supply-chain emissions tracking
PAS 2080:2023 verification for carbon management in infrastructure achieved Q4 2024
Company awarded London Stock Exchange Green Economy Mark in 2024
